GUIDELINES FOR TESTERS(this are suggestions but we would really appreciate any tester keeping close to them):

 

-If you plan to test CDLC on a constant or semi-constant basis please let Olorin or myself know(its much more convenient for us if you do it via PM, BTW) that way we will add you to the list.

-Its not a job, you can do it on your own speed but we do ask you to report your feedback in at least two places, 1) the CDLC/workshop post of that particular song and also the GOOGLE DOC(link up there).

-If you report feedback at the CDLC post please go as much in detail as you feel to but when posting feedback in the google doc please try to keep it short and simple, read the first feedbacks to see how we did it and take from that example.

-Also please be sure to post links to the particular file you are reviewing for clarity sake.

 

A little explanation on the google docs entries logic:

 

As you can see we have the basic information colums: Artist, Song, Testers, Link, Status and Feedback.

 

***Artist/Song: self explanatory, name of the artist and the particular song you tested.

***Testers: basically, US, you, whoever has valid feedback for the CDLC.

***Link: link to the CDLCDB/WORKSHOP/FILE you tested, try to keep them valid in case the autor of the CDLC changes something.

***Status: The current status of the TESTING DONE on the CLDC, NOT the status of the charter project/CDLC, i.e. if it needs more TESTING, if it has been fully tested or not, personally i manage 2 status, FULLY TESTED(which i color GREEN) and AWAITING TESTERS (means me or someone tested the CDLC but would also like for more people to give us feedback on that particular CDLC, specially if i/we didnt tested ALL the features in the song, for example i only tested the bass but no lead)

***Feedback: BASIC feedback, specially short comments that summarize your findings, feel free to go into more detail when posting in the particular CDLC entry at the database or workshop post.

For example: 

 

"Lead: good but tone is too muddy/overdriven, rhythm: good but a bit imprecise at the end, bass: great"

 

As you can see you give info on what and where needs work but you can go into waaay more detail at the post of that CDLC on the DB.
